The Washington Commanders enter the 2024 NFL Draft Thursday night with nine picks over the three-day event.

The new era of Commanders football is going next level. After refreshing the decision-makers by hiring general manager Adam Peters and coach Dan Quinn, and revamping the roster with over 20 new free agents, the core pieces are coming to town.

The Commanders have six selections in the top 100, headlined by the No. 2 pick, which is expected to become a quarterback. Which one? LSU’s Jayden Daniels is the presumptive favorite. We’ll know for sure Thursday evening, along with whether Washington trades back into the first round for help at offensive tackle or the defense.
